Brief summary

This study will assess the safety, tolerability, pharmacokinetics and antineoplastic activity of CT-707 in combination with toripalimab and gemcitabine in patients with advanced pancreatic cancer

Detailed description

This is a phase Ib/II, open-label, dose-escalation and dose-expansion study to evaluate the safety, tolerability, pharmacokinetics and antineoplastic activity of CT-707 in combination with toripalimab and gemcitabine in patients with advanced pancreatic cancer.The study consists of two parts, dose-escalation part and dose-expansion part. Both parts will enroll patients with advanced pancreatic cancer. Dose-escalation study is designed to determine the dose-limiting toxicity (DLTs) and recommended phase II dose (RP2D), and to characterize the safety, tolerability, and pharmacokinetics (PK) profile of CT-707 in combination with toripalimab and gemcitabine. Dose-expansion study phase is designed to evaluate the antitumor activity (objective response rate, progression-free survival, overall survival) of CT-707 in combination with toripalimab and gemcitabine in patients with advanced pancreatic cancer.

Inclusion criteria

* For inclusion in this study, patients must fulfil the following criteria: 1. Male or female (age of 18\ 75 years old). 2. Patients must have Eastern Cooperative Oncology Group (ECOG) performance status of 0 or 1. 3. Patients must have a life expectancy of ≥ 3 months. 4. Patients must have histologically or cytologically confirmed advanced pancreatic adenocarcinoma or poorly differentiated pancreatic carcinoma that is metastatic to distant sites. 5. Patients are required to have measurable disease (RECIST v1.1), defined as at least one lesion that can be accurately measured in at least one dimension (longest diameter to be recorded) as \> 20 mm with conventional techniques or as \> 10 mm with spiral CT scan. 6. Patients must have adequate organ and marrow function as defined below: Blood routine: Absolute neutrophil count (ANC) ≥ 1.5×10\^9/L; Platelet count (PLT) ≥ 100×10\^9/L; Hemoglobin (HGB) ≥ 90 g/L. Liver function: Aspartate aminotransferase (AST) and Alanine aminotransferase (ALT) ≤ 2.5 times upper limit of normal (ULN), total bilirubin (TBIL) ≤ 1.5 times ULN in patients without liver metastases; AST and ALT ≤ 5 times ULN, TBIL ≤3 times ULN in patients with liver metastases. Renal function: Serum creatinine (Scr) ≤1.5 times ULN or creatinine clearance ≥60 mL/min/1.73 m2. Coagulation function: Activated partial thromboplastin time (APTT) ≤ 1.5 times ULN; International Normalized ratio (INR) ≤ 1.5 times ULN. 7. Patients must have recovered from any acute adverse events (except alopecia and peripheral neurotoxicity ≤ Grade 2). 8. Patients of reproductive potential must agree to use an effective contraceptive method during participation in this trial and for 6 months after the trial; female participants must have a negative serum pregnancy test within 7 days prior to treatment.
